The Cosplay Queen in Figure Form
Marin Kitagawa is one of the most beloved anime characters of recent years, and this officially licensed Taito T-Most figure does full justice to her vibrant personality and charm. The Shizuku Kuroe version shows Marin dressed as the iconic game character, capturing one of the most memorable cosplay moments from My Dress-Up Darling with exceptional sculpt quality and rich, accurate color work throughout every detail of the figure.
Taito is known for delivering figures that look as good in person as they do in promotional images, and this one is no exception. The carefully crafted base stand keeps Marin perfectly poised for display on any surface, while the official licensing guarantees authentic design accuracy straight from the source material that fans love. The quality of the paintwork and the expressiveness of the face sculpt make this one stand out immediately.
